【轉】ASP.NET 網站配置問題

(本文來源於網絡,我在此基礎上做了一點點修改)

在進行ASP.NET網站配置時,點擊“安全”選項卡後出現問題如下:

問題: 出現瞭如下錯誤選定的數據存儲區出現問題,原因可能是服務器名稱或憑據無效,或者權限不足。也可能是未啓用角色管理器功能造成的。請單擊下面的按鈕,以重定向到可以選擇新數據存儲區的頁。
下面的消息可能會有助於診斷問題: 無法連接到 SQL Server 數據庫。


解決方法:
1、打開Visual Studio的命令提示,輸入aspnet_regsql,用默認的數據庫(aspnetdb)。
2、打開Visual Studio,依次:工具-->選項-->數據庫工具-->數據連接-->SQL Server實例名稱(默認爲空),改爲你的服務器名稱。
3、還是VS,工具-->連接到數據庫-->服務器名(選擇剛纔的服務器),可以按你要求選擇Windows或SQL Server身份驗證,然後數據庫選擇剛纔的aspnetdb。測試OK後,在高級裏複製出語句Data Source=Server;Initial Catalog=aspnetdb;User ID=sa;Password=sa
4、打開IIS:默認網站-->屬性-->ASP.NET-->編輯全局配置-->常規-->連接字符串管理器LocalSqlServer的連接字符串改爲Data Source=Server;Initial Catalog=aspnetdb;User ID=sa;Password=sa。
5、還是在IIS:默認網站-->屬性-->ASP.NET-->編輯全局配置-->身份驗證-->選定"啓用角色管理"
關於 AspNetDB.mdf 由於沒有aspnetdb.mdf數據庫,因此得先建立一個,這個可以通過aspnet_regsql.exe完成,該程序位於C:WINDOWSMicrosoft.NET Frameworkv2.0.50727下。1、運行它之後會彈出的窗口:按"Next >"按鈕2、我們會發現除了有配置數據庫外,還有刪除數據庫的功能,以後說不定可以派上用場,現在自然選Configure SQL Server for application services,按"Next >"按鈕
3、現在進入數據庫選擇界面,如果SQLSERVER就安裝在本地的話,可以不用改任何東西,直接按"Next >"。這裏的Database顯示爲,表示默認數據庫名爲aspnetdb,你也可以根據自己的需要更改名稱。
4、可以開始安裝數據庫了,當Finish按鈕亮起時,表明數據庫安裝成功,一切順利!

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章